About this episode
Chief Digital Instructor for Golf Digest Michael Breed sits down with Trey to discuss the role that golf has played throughout his life and some of the deeper meanings behind the sport. Michael shares how he got involved in the game of golf and why the camaraderie of the game is so important to him. He also explains how having Dyslexia impacted his life and ... Show More
